Sep 23, 2007Inefficient MSMQ load balancing
New to bigip and msmq.
How can I get 1:1 messages LB across queues.

Sep 24, 2007If the client opens up 1 tcp connection and sends 100 "messages" down this one connection, the BIG-IP LTM only knows about the 1 connection, not the messages inside the connection because the BIG-IP LTM is not an MQ proxy. While load balancing MQ, it can only know about the tcp side of the house. You can use iRules to inspect this traffic, but as for load balancing seperate messages inside one tcp connections, I'm not sure how that could be done.
